When ordering top dressing, first determine the surface area and multiply by the depth of top dressing desired, generally, 1/8 to ¼ inch (3-6 mm.). Some extremely fertile, fast-growing grass areas need a thicker layer of top dressing and require top dressing more often. For small areas, use a garden shovel and the back side of a heavy garden rake to spread a thin layer of topdressing. Once the soil is spread evenly, turn the rake over and use the tines to lightly comb through the grass. As a side effect of the decomposition process of the compost, the live organisms ...If the area of lawn requiring evening out is only slightly uneven then you can apply a top dressing up to 12mm at once. For areas that are deeper than 12mms apply one layer of 12mm first and then add another layer. Shovel the loam or sand onto the lawn in even piles and then level with a garden leveller. If your lawn drains poorly, topdressing with sandy soil can assist with drainage, disease and pest resistance.At this point, your lawn should be much more level and full of nutrients. 5mm in topsoil equates to 4-5kg per square meter of lawn. To work out how much topsoil you need, simply multiply your lawns square meterage by the weight in soil per square meter. So lets say your lawn is 50 square meters. 50 x 5 = 250kg.Steps: Mow and dethatch your lawn before topdressing. Broadcast Level Mix over lawn with a shovel or compost spreader.
